SsangYong launches the Tivoli 4x4xFree
As the cold winter weather starts to bite, SsangYong is
introducing a 4x4 winter upgrade offer on its 1.6 litre turbo
diesel Tivoli SUV and extended bodied Tivoli XLV models.
The offer applies to current EX and ELX models, manual
and automatic, and registered before 31st January 2017.

Sharing the same platform and
2,600mm wheelbase as the Tivoli,
the Tivoli XLV SUV estate features
a lengthened body from behind
the C pillar, an increase of 238mm
over the standard car, expanding
the load capacity to a huge 720
cubic litres of space.

In conjunction with the standard
electronic stability program (ESP)
with hydraulic brake assist and 4channel anti-lock braking system
(ABS), the four-wheel drive system
provides the best possible grip
and control whatever the
conditions. Hill start assist (HSA)
and active roll-over protection
(ARP) also feature.
The Tivoli 4x4 also features
multi-link rear suspension for a
comfortable drive on the road, and
increased wheel articulation for
optimum grip off-road.
